Shock result in Australia's federal elections

Labor leader Bill Shorten has accepted defeat.

The ruling centre-right coalition led by Prime Minister Scott Morrison looks set to return to power against the predictions of the pollsters.

Exit polls had suggested a narrow victory for the Labor party for the first time in six years, but Bill Shorten has accepted defeat.

Voting in Australia is mandatory, and a record 16.4 million voters were enrolled for the election.
